Jelly Roll Reflects on Past Infidelity and Its Impact on Marriage

Jelly Roll, the popular country artist known for his heartfelt lyrics, has candidly shared details about his past infidelity. During an appearance on the “Human School Podcast” on October 21, 2023, the singer, whose real name is Jason Bradley DeFord, opened up about cheating on his wife, Bunnie Xo, a revelation he described as one of the worst moments of his adulthood.

Reflecting on his actions, Jelly Roll acknowledged that his social circle at the time contributed to his poor choices. He revealed, “I was hanging around a bunch of people that were cheating on their wives.” The artist admitted that he was often influenced by those around him, stating, “When I was doing cocaine, I was hanging around a bunch of people that were doing cocaine. When I was drinking a lot, I was hanging around a lot of people that were drinking a lot.” This environment, he explained, played a significant role in his decision-making.

Path to Recovery and Reconciliation

Since that challenging period, Jelly Roll has made considerable changes in his life. He has distanced himself from friends he described as “horrible humans” and has committed to sobriety. The artist emphasized that he used to take pride in the length of his friendships, which he now recognizes were not beneficial to his well-being.

Despite their temporary separation in 2018, Jelly Roll and Bunnie Xo managed to rebuild their relationship stronger than before. Their romance began in 2015 when they met and later started dating in 2016, culminating in an impulsive marriage in Las Vegas on the night he proposed. Following their split in 2018, the couple reconciled later that year, suggesting that the experience fortified their bond.

In a recent TikTok video, shared in February 2023, Bunnie Xo reflected on their journey together. She noted, “Who knew that us breaking up in 2018, me moving back to Vegas & you coming to get me back – would have put us on this wild journey called life.” She continued, highlighting their renewed commitment to each other, stating, “Our castle in the sand had to crumble so we could rebuild on solid ground.”
